Default How many of you want just one more to savor?

I remember one day in February 2005 getting into the shower and thinking to myself that after 3 championships in 4 years that it was going to be a great next few years as we three-peated and won an ungodly amount of championships. I would have bet my life then and there that Peyton Manning or his stupid little brother would never even see a Superbowl let alone win one. I thought it would last forever, why wouldn't it?

Now after the heartbreak of 2006 and the even more devastating heartbreak of 2007 and seeing Brady hurt in 2008 and the playoffs of last year I have come to realize just how special even 1 championship is. I realize now what we had back then. And I want it back, even just 1, just 1 more to really savor, like that last M&M in the bag.

I heard Parcells say something similar in his documentary, and Brady has as well, the next one is always the best one.

I know as far as being a fan, I will never take it for granted again. I promise, just one more guys. I just want to get this bad taste from 2007 out of my mouth.

Funny, I felt the same way. A few days after XXXIX, a friend called me and asked "Does it get old watching your team win a championship?". Back then, it almost was. I was happy that 3rd win gave them the Dynasty label, but I was more expecting them to win than excited for them to win that day.

I kick myself now for not enjoying it more. I think my feelings were back then "No one can stop this...they might go 6 for 7!". And after the 2006 in Indy, and the 2007 garbage; I only appreciate the wins now. The Browns game really reinforced that this year also...don't EXPECT to win anything. Just enjoy when they do.

I really want another banner hung in Foxboro, but I will appreciate and enjoy every win this team gives us. My days of "expecting" them are over.
